§ 22-3-4-10 — Actions and proceedings; costs

Text

In all proceedings before the worker's compensation board or in a court under IC 22-3-2 through IC 22-3-6, the costs shall be awarded and taxed as provided by law in ordinary civil actions in the circuit court. Formerly: Acts 1929, c.172, s.63. As amended by P.L.144-1986, SEC.47; P.L.28-1988, SEC.39.
